WebOpenWind is an open source software application used to model wind farms. Users are able to design wind farms, including wind turbine layout and electrical design. Energy production, turbine noise levels, turbine wake losses, and turbine suitability can be calculated. OpenWind is being developed by AWS Truepower, a wind power consulting company. WebHenvey Inlet Wind is the largest First Nation wind energy partnership in Canada. Henvey Inlet First Nation, through its subsidiary Nigig Power Corporation, partnered with Pattern Canada in 2014 to jointly develop, construct, and operate the 300 MW Henvey Inlet Wind site and its associated transmission line. 01 / 03. Wind farms are areas in which many large wind turbines have been grouped together. You “harvest” the power of the wind. These big turbines look a bit like super-tall windmills. In a large wind farm, hundreds of wind turbines can be distributed over hundreds of kilometers.
